2010-07-22 4 views
1

FreeImage .NET 래퍼를 사용하는 ASP.NET 프로젝트가 있습니다. 이것은 외부 디렉토리에 대한 참조를 사용하여로드됩니다. 래퍼는 FreeImage.dll이 작동하는지 (명확하게)에 의존합니다.Visual Studio 2010 웹 프로젝트에서 외부 리소스에 대한 링크 포함

Visual Studio에서 FreeImage dll에 대한 참조를 포함시키는 방법은 무엇입니까? 그것은. NET 어셈블리가 아니에요, 내가 다른 것에서 만들어 졌다고 생각합니다. 그래서 참조로 추가 할 수 없습니다.

이 정말이 파일은 다른 SVN 저장소

+0

.NET 어셈블리가 아니라는 것은 무엇을 의미합니까? Microsoft에서 작성하지 않았거나 .NET 언어로 작성하고 컴파일하지 않았습니까? –

+0

후자는 Visual Studio 6에서 작성된 것 같습니다. 래퍼는 관리되지 않는 코드를 참조하는 것으로 나타납니다 –

답변

1

빌드 할 때마다 파일을 복사하기 위해 미리 빌드 매크로/스크립트를 추가하십시오. visstudio afaik에 기호 링크를 추가 할 수있는 방법이 없습니다.

0

나는 C#을 같은 .NET 지원 언어를 사용하여 제작 된 .DLL을 가정하고에 상주으로이 프로젝트에 대한 복사본을 가지고 싶지 않아.

사이트를 마우스 오른쪽 버튼으로 클릭하고 '참조 추가'를 선택할 수 있습니다.

찾고있는 .dll로 이동 한 다음 '확인'을 클릭하여 추가하십시오.

사이트 및 DLL에 .refresh 파일을 추가해야합니다. .refresh 파일은 사이트에 .dll의 상대 위치를 사이트에 알리는 소스 컨트롤에 체크 된 파일입니다.

+0

미안하지만 명확하지 않은 것은 어셈블리가 아니므로이 방식으로 추가 할 수 없습니다 –

관련 문제